From Officer to Hawthorn East by train

To get from Officer to Hawthorn East in Melbourne, take the PAKENHAM train from Officer station to Richmond station. Next, take the LILYDALE train from Richmond station to Auburn station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 26 min. The ride fare is A$5.30.
